The Joy of Meyer Lemons
Meyer lemons are a delightful hybrid of a lemon and a mandarin orange, known for their thinner skin and sweeter, less acidic flavor. This unique citrus fruit adds a special touch to your baking, elevating simple recipes with its vibrant aroma and refreshing taste. Tips for Baking Success
To ensure your Meyer Lemon Poppy Seed Bread turns out perfectly, be sure to measure your ingredients accurately. Use the spoon and level method for flour: spoon it into your measuring cup and level it off with a knife. This prevents your bread from becoming dense. Additionally, room temperature ingredients, especially butter and eggs, create a smoother batter and contribute to a lighter texture.
Don’t forget to check the freshness of your baking powder and baking soda. Expired leavening agents can cause your bread to bake unevenly or not rise properly. If you’re unsure, you can test baking soda by adding a bit of vinegar; it should fizz immediately. Following these simple tips will help you achieve a delicious loaf every time!
Ingredients
For the Bread
- 1 ½ cups all-purpose flour
- 1 teaspoon baking powder
- ½ teaspoon baking soda
- ¼ teaspoon salt
- 2 tablespoons poppy seeds
- ½ cup unsalted butter, softened
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- 2 large eggs
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- Zest of 2 Meyer lemons
- ½ cup buttermilk
- ¼ cup fresh Meyer lemon juice
Mix well and ensure all ingredients are combined evenly.
Instructions
Preheat the Oven
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a 9x5 inch loaf pan.
Mix Dry Ingredients
In a b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t, and poppy seeds.
Cream Butter and Sugar
In another large bowl, cream together the softened butter and sugar until light and fluffy.
Add Eggs and Flavorings
Beat in the eggs one at a time, then stir in the vanilla extract and lemon zest.
Combine Wet and Dry Ingredients
Gradually mix in the dry ingredients alternating with the buttermilk and lemon juice until just combined.
Bake
Pour the batter into the prepared loaf pan and bake for 50 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
Cool and Serve
Allow the bread to cool in the pan for 10 min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.

Serving Suggestions
This Meyer Lemon Poppy Seed Bread is delightful on its own, but you can elevate it even further with a glaze or spread. A simple lemon glaze made with powdered sugar and lemon juice drizzled over the top adds a sweet and tangy finish, enhancing the citrus flavor. For a more indulgent treat, consider serving it with whipped cream cheese or a lemon-infused butter.

Storing and Freezing
To keep your Meyer Lemon Poppy Seed Bread fresh, store it in an airtight container at room temperature for up to three days. If you want to enjoy it later, consider freezing individual slices. Wrap each slice tightly in plastic wrap and place them in a freezer-safe bag. When you’re ready to enjoy them, simply thaw at room temperature or pop them in the microwave for a few seconds.

Questions About Recipes
→ Can I use regular lemons instead of Meyer lemons?
Yes, you can use regular lemons, but the flavor will be slightly more tart.
→ How should I store the bread?
Store the bread in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days.
→ Can I freeze the bread?
Yes, you can freeze the bread for up to 3 months. Wrap it tightly in plastic wrap and foil.
→ What can I serve with this bread?
This bread pairs wonderfully with butter, cream cheese, or even a lemon glaze.
